I'm curious (and struggling to find something definitive on the internet ) about the difference between the Polo GTI TSI 2.0L and Audi A1 40 TFSI 2.0L. Everything I read says the Polo has a TSI engine while the Audi uses a TFSI engine yet they use the exact same power plants and performance figures are identical.

I've always understood that TFSI refers to "Turbo Fuel Stratified Injection" while TSI refers to "Turbocharged Stratified Injection."
Defined as:
TSI is Turbo Stratified injection i.e direct injection in a gasoline engine(petrol) with forced induction(turbo charger).
TFSI is Turbo Fuel Stratified injection i.e direct injection in gasoline engine (petrol) with turbo charger.
Here is the site explaining the difference in depth: https://www.quora.com/What-is-the-diffe ... FSI-engine

Or is it just all marketing buzz words now?

It is same engine. I have DKZC in my GTI. Btw DKZC are with OPF while without OPF had CZPC code.
